About Us:
ChowNow is one of the leading players in off-premise restaurant technology. As takeout becomes a vital revenue stream for independent restaurants, our platform helps owners focus on what they do best—serving great food—by offering solutions across the entire digital dining experience. From building branded websites and mobile apps, to powering online orders, managing menus, consolidating delivery, and running targeted marketing, we give restaurants the tools to grow on their own terms.
We support over 20,000 restaurants across North America, helping process $1B+ in gross food sales while saving our partners over $700M in third-party commission fees. Through our white-label ordering solutions, a growing demand network (including Google, Yelp, Apple, and Snap), and a diner-friendly marketplace, we empower independent restaurants to own their customer relationships and avoid inflated pricing and fees charged by 3rd party delivery apps like Uber and Doordash.
Founded in 2012, we’ve navigated rapid growth and transformation—from startup roots through the pandemic boom—and are now beginning an exciting new era under our CEO, Kanika Soni.
